Best Quotes about Learning

1.
We learn by teaching.
Proverb

2.
People are constantly clamoring for the joy of life. As for me, I find the joy of life in the hard and cruel battle of life -- to learn something is a joy to me.
Strindberg, J. August

3.
Much learning does not teach understanding.
Heraclitus

4.
The things which hurt, instruct.
Franklin, Benjamin

5.
As we acquire more knowledge, things do not become more comprehensible but more mysterious.
Schweitzer, Albert

6.
That is what learning is. You suddenly understand something you've understood all your life, but in a new way.
Doris Lessing

7.
The wise are instructed by reason, average minds by experience, the stupid by necessity and the brute by instinct.
Cicero, Marcus T.

8.
How well I have learned that there is no fence to sit on between heaven and hell. There is a deep, wide gulf, a chasm, and in that chasm is no place for any man.
Cash, Johnny

9.
The years teach us much the days never knew.
Emerson, Ralph Waldo

10.
No one as ever completed their apprenticeship.
Goethe, Johann Wolfgang Von

11.
True, a little learning is a dangerous thing, but it still beats total ignorance.
Van Buren, Abigail

12.
Only those who have learned a lot are in a position to admit how little they know.
Carte, L.

13.
In every man there is something wherein I may learn of him, and in that I am his pupil.
Emerson, Ralph Waldo

14.
Some people will never learn anything well, because they understand everything too soon.

15.
There are some things which cannot be learned quickly, and time, which is all we have, must be paid heavily for their acquiring. They are the very simplest things and because it takes a man's life to know them the little new that each man gets from life is very costly and the only heritage he has to leave.
Hemingway, Ernest

16.
The best results are achieved by using the right amount of effort in the right place at the right time. And this right amount is usually less than we think we need. In other words, the less unnecessary effort you put into learning, the more successful you'll be... the key to faster learning is to use appropriate effort. Greater effort can exacerbate faulty patterns of action. Doing the wrong thing with more intensity rarely improves the situation. Learning something new often requires us to unlearn something old.
Buzan, Tony

17.
The difference between what the most and the least learned people know is inexpressibly trivial in relation to that which is unknown.
Einstein, Albert
